Nigerian crypto and web3 company, Lazerpay, has halted its operations after its inability to raise funding.
This was contained in a statement from Njoku Emmanuel, founder, and CEO of Lazerpay on Friday.
Lazerpay, which debuted in 2021, functioned like Stripe except for cryptocurrency.
Ripples Nigeria gathered that the company laid off some of its employees last November after the proposed lead investor for its seed round withdrew its interest due to the “market conditions and disagreement on terms”.
“Despite our team’s tireless efforts to secure the necessary funding to keep Lazerpay going, we were unable to close a successful fundraising round,” Njoku said.
Njoku added that all Lazerpay merchants should use the bank or cryptocurrency payout options to remove their monies from the system no later than April 30.
